CAMP/TRIP CREDITS

 Throughout the years, the Booster Association for String Students (BASS) has provided monetary assistance for music related activities, such as, summer music camps, extended field trips for the high school students, and various music related experiences. Assistance is determined by the amount of time and effort the parents are involved in BASS activities. Parents earn camp/trip credits for their child in various activities. Each credit is worth $5.00. Credits accumulate from June to the following June (June 2000- June 2001). If the student does not use his/her credits for a music related event during that year or summer, the money goes into the general fund of BASS. The only exception to this rule is for the high school students who may use credit from the preceding year for the following year’s orchestra trip. The camp credit checks for those students going to music camp, are presented at the annual Awards Night. Every student who has earned credit and is going to a music camp will receive a check made payable to the camp.

 There are numerous ways to earn credits which are worth $5.00 each.
